Responsibilities

Manage the initiation, development, and completion of responsive Proposals to Requests for Proposals (RFPs), and assist with the development of associated products, such as Requests for Information responses, capabilities statements, white papers, briefings, etc
Lead collaborative proposal kick-offs with relevant program and functional stakeholders to ensure communication of proposal strategy, requirements and schedule
Establish proposal schedule and drive cross-functional teams to meet commitment dates
Lead rhythmic reviews of proposal portfolios to maintain status and dates
Collaborate with business management in developing NCTA cost estimates related to proposal development and provide subsequent oversight and tracking of NCTA funds
Oversee compliance with proposal knowledge management processes; develop and maintain a centralized proposal library (solicitations, responses, debriefings) or other reusable knowledge database(s)
Support development and refinement of templates, and standardized processes to streamline proposal development

Required

Must have a Bachelor's Degree with 5 years, Master's Degree with 3 years, or in lieu of degree 9 years related experience. Experience must be in the following Supply Chain; Project Management, Sustainment, Proposals and/or Capture Efforts, Resource Planning, Accounting, Program Management, Program Scheduling, Program Cost Analysis, Subcontracts Administration, Procurement, Business Management, or Contracts
Experience in Microsoft Office Suite
Ability to obtain and maintain a DoD Secret Clearance and Special Program Access in reasonable time frame deemed by Company needs
Has served at least 180 days on active duty
Is within 12 months of separation or retirement
Will receive an honorable discharge
Has taken any service TAPS/TGPS
Has attended or participated in an ethics brief within the last 12 months
Received Unit Commander (first O-4/Field Grade commander in chain of command) written authorization and approval to participate in DoD SkillBridge Program prior to start of internship
